Cutting and stacking wood. Forest fire is a real concern in the mountains. As a matter of fact there were two fires this summer near the cabin. One was 10 miles away and another was 15. Fire mitigation is a very serious thing. Clearing downed and dead trees goes along way in protecting one's property. The men cut the trees down and Sandy stacked the wood.
My contribution the to the work was using the jeep to tow logs out of the woods for easier cutting and stacking. A hard job I assure you.
